Arthur Smith contacted by North Carolina but chooses to stay with Steelers


Pittsburgh Steelers offensive coordinator, Arthur Smith, was recently contacted about the head coaching position at North Carolina, but he expressed his contentment with his current role in Pittsburgh. Smith, who played college football at North Carolina, mentioned that while he appreciates the opportunity and loves the school, he feels he has one of the best jobs in football and is happy where he is. The North Carolina coaching job became available after Mack Brown was fired this week. Smith, who is in his first season with the Steelers after being let go as head coach of the Atlanta Falcons, emphasized that his personal and professional happiness in Pittsburgh is invaluable. He stated that his perspective on coaching jobs has changed over the years, and he is no longer as eager to pursue every opportunity that comes his way. Smith’s remarks reflect his commitment to the Steelers organization and his satisfaction with his current position. Despite the potential for a return to his alma mater as head coach, Smith seems dedicated to his role in Pittsburgh and the positive environment he has found with the Steelers.
